
Mark your calendars, Dallas! The 25th Anniversary of DFW Restaurant Week is here from August 8 - September 4, and we are celebrating in a big way. We're offering Restaurant Week menus in Terra and La Pizza & La Pasta.
Every year, North Texas's largest culinary event - DFW Restaurant Week - returns, opening the doors to the city's best restaurants as their top chefs offer amazing menus at affordable prices. And this year, to celebrate the 25th anniversary of DFW Restaurant Week, two of our restaurants are participating: Terra and La Pizza & La Pasta!
From August 8 - September 4, join us for a three-course dinner in Terra for $49, a three-course dinner in La Pizza & La Pasta for $39, and, for the first time - a weekend brunch in Terra for $29 during DFW Restaurant Week.
From antipasti to dolci, the menus flex to all preferences. The best part is that you're doing good by dining with us - a portion of your DFW Restaurant Week order will be donated to North Texas Food Bank and Lena Pope!
